Summary

The rate of reaction is the change in concentration of a reactant or product per unit time. It is increased by raising concentration, pressure, temperature and surface area, and by a catalyst — all explained by the collision theory. In a reversible reaction at dynamic equilibrium, Le Chatelier's principle predicts the effect of any change.
